When trying to login with a GitHub account, an alert saying "You don't have any email as public email in your GitHub account" pops up.

@dmlittle I understand, this it is a little bit confusing :(

You need to go to your "Profile" and after the input with your name exists another input to select which email you want use as public email, the default value is "none".
